Recognizing Oral Stress And Anxiety and Concern



To recognize dental anxiousness and concern, you must identify the typical signs and causes.

Many individuals experience a range of signs and symptoms when it pertains to checking out the dentist. These can include boosted heart price, sweating, trembling, and feelings of panic or fear. Some individuals might additionally avoid dental visits entirely because of their concern.

The sources of oral stress and anxiety and concern can vary from one person to another. It might originate from a previous stressful dental experience, concern of discomfort or needles, or a general sensation of vulnerability or loss of control. Additionally, dental stress and anxiety can be affected by exterior factors such as negative stories or experiences shared by others.

Comprehending these symptoms and triggers is essential in order to address and conquer oral anxiety and concern.

Discovering Relaxation Strategies for Dental Visits



Attempt incorporating mindfulness techniques into your dental sees to advertise leisure and ease any stress and anxiety or fear you may have. Mindfulness entails focusing your focus on the present minute and accepting it without judgment.

Take slow-moving, deep breaths in via your nose and breathe out gradually through your mouth. This can assist relax your nerve system and minimize stress and anxiety.

Another technique is progressive muscular tissue leisure. Begin by tensing and then launching each muscle group in your body, beginning with your toes and working your way up to your head. This can help release tension and promote leisure.
